Eye micromovements play a significant role in the of visual information processing. Mostly their analysis is to detect microsaccades and evaluate the frequency of occurrence. In this paper a simplified double-circuit model of a motion control system is proposed to study micromovements as a random process. By splitting the actual recording into two components, it is possible to separate and analyze the eye micromovements. A fast nonparametric smoothing algorithm was proposed and tested, which allows to find an estimate of the eye path components.
